CrowdStrike Holdings Inc., a renowned provider of endpoint security solutions, has gained a reputation for its advanced threat detection and proactive defense mechanisms. The company's Falcon platform, which leverages art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ning for real-time threat detection, has been instrumental in its success.

Recently, CrowdStrike released its 2025 Threat Hunting Report, revealing a significant shift in the cybersecurity landscape. Adversaries are now weaponizing generative AI (GenAI) to scale cyberattacks, particularly targeting autonomous AI systems and cloud infrastructure. This includes sophisticated attacks that exploit AI agents to steal credentials and deploy malware, making autonomous systems a critical and emerging enterprise attack surface. In response, CrowdStrike is developing AI-powered tools like Falcon and Charlotte to automate threat detection and response, aiming to stay ahead of these evolving threats.

Despite a 36.46% drop in trading volume, CrowdStrike's stock rose 1.84% on August 4, 2025, reflecting investor confidence in its AI-driven cybersecurity strategy. Since 2022, CrowdStrike's high-volume stock strategy has delivered a 166.71% return[1][2][3][4][5].
